As a long term patient, it never been as bad.. it is suppose to be a home from home. Not enough staff, especially CNA's and nurses. Even housekeeping staff can use more help.

My wife is in rehab at Regency Care of Arlington. They provide physical therapy. The staff are friendly. My wife is sort of out of it. So of course, she doesn't like eating there. The food seems OK. The communication is very good. Her room is very clean. There's no dining room; they don't have an area where visitors can stay. She is comfortable in her room. The facility is OK. They keep it clean.

I visited Regency Care of Arlington and they gave me a tour. It looks like a very open place, and they have each resident in one room, so it's separated. It's not like there are two patients in one room, but only one patient per room. It looks clean to me and spacious, and the person who gave us the tour was nice. She was very pleasant and answered all the questions we asked. The place is clean and private.

I called to get information on their Alzheimer's unit and using medicare and medicaid for payment. The person I was transferred to said that yes they had a unit and yes they accepted medicare and medicaid but they were full. I asked about a waitlist and she had no idea what I meant. After I explained it to her she said no and the best thing for me to do is to call back every week. Then she hung up and no one would answer the phone when I called back. This must be a very poorly run place.
